
On May 26, 2025, a product recall was issued concerning black pepper 100g Columbia, marketed in the Carrefour brands throughout France. This product, packaged in plastic pots and intended to be kept at room temperature, is affected by a sanitary alert due to the detection of B1 aflatoxins at levels exceeding the regulatory thresholds.
Aflatoxins B1 are mycotoxins produced by certain molds, in particular Aspergillus flavus And Aspergillus parasiticusand can present a risk to human health.

What are the risks to health?
AFLATOXINS B1 are recognized for their carcinogen and genotoxic potential for humans. The consumption of products containing high levels of Aflatoxins B1 can increase the risk of developing liver disease and cancer, in particular liver cancer. These toxins can also affect the immune system.
